What is Cloud Identity Management?

As businesses embrace remote work and the transformation to the cloud, the need for robust identity management is key. But what exactly is cloud identity management, and why is it critical? Essentially, cloud identity management orchestrates identity and access management (IAM) in cloud environments and supports the shifting of authentication and authorization processes to the cloud.

Enterprise Browsers Need to Secure Identities Without Compromise

Now is the time. It’s been over 30 years since the introduction of the first web browser. Since then, the browser has evolved into an application that allows us to stream entertainment, work and interact through social media. It’s the most widely used application among consumers … and now the enterprise. Unfortunately, there’s little separation between work and personal life when you use a browser designed for consumer use.
